Sada Thompson, born on September twenty-seventh, nineteen twenty-seven, was a distinguished American actress whose talents spanned stage, film, and television. She captivated audiences with her performances, particularly in the realm of theater, where she garnered significant acclaim on Broadway.
Thompson's remarkable career took a notable turn when she starred as Kate Lawrence in the beloved television series Family from nineteen seventy-six to nineteen eighty. Her portrayal earned her the prestigious Emmy Award for Outstanding Lead Actress in a Drama Series in nineteen seventy-eight, solidifying her status as a household name.
Before her television success, Thompson made her mark in the theater world, winning a Tony Award for Best Actress in a Play for her role in Twigs in nineteen seventy-two.
